Identification of robust and reproducible CT‐texture metrics using a customized 3D‐printed texture phantom
Journal of Applied Clinical Medical Physics ( IF 2.1 ) Pub Date : 2021-01-12 , DOI: 10.1002/acm2.13162
Bino A Varghese 1 , Darryl Hwang 1 , Steven Y Cen 1 , Xiaomeng Lei 1 , Joshua Levy 2 , Bhushan Desai 1 , David J Goodenough 3 , Vinay A Duddalwar 1
Affiliation  

The objective of this study was to evaluate the robustness and reproducibility of computed tomography‐based texture analysis (CTTA) metrics extracted from CT images of a customized texture phantom built for assessing the association of texture metrics to three‐dimensional (3D) printed progressively increasing textural heterogeneity.
